Docker 是一个开源的应用容器引擎,基于 Go 语言 并遵从Apache2.0协议开源。而Jenkins是一个功能强大的应用程序,允许持续集成和持续交付项目,无论用的是什么平台。这是一个免费的源代码,可以处理任何类型的构建或持续集成。集成Jenkins可以用于一些测试和部署技术。Jenkins是一种软件允许持续集成。 初
转载
2023-08-18 15:27:07
117阅读
一、Docker简介 Docker是一个开源的容器引擎,它有助于更快地交付应用。 Docker可将应用程序和基础设施层隔离,并且能将基础设施当作程序一样进行管理。使用 Docker可更快地打包、测试以及部署应用程序,并可以缩短从编写到部署运行代码的周期。Docker的优点如下:1、简化程序Docker让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器
转载
2023-08-18 15:27:18
105阅读
Jenkins、Kubernetes和Docker是软件开发中使用的不同工具,它们各自担负不同的任务。Jenkins是一种自动化服务器,提供持续集成和持续交付(CI/CD)服务。它用于自动构建、测试和部署软件项目,有助于简化软件开发过程下面是 Jenkins 的一些基本用法: 1、安装 Jenkins: 首先需要安装 Jenkins,可以从官网下载对应操作系统的安装包进行安装 2、创建 Jenki
转载
2023-09-02 17:41:03
194阅读
想坚持更新自己的博客这个想法已经很久了,一直都没有迈开第一步。在2018年的最后日子里迈开了这一步。Jenkins和docker做持续集成主要是缘由是因为公司在.net的路上转头向.net core 发展,由于.net core的版本更新比较频繁在linux上安装和卸载.net core不太方便,于是有了Jenkins+docker的组合。Jenkins主要是负责持续集成,docker实际负责集成
转载
2024-07-03 15:40:13
46阅读
1 介绍(知识点)1.1 Jenkins介绍 Jenkins是一个开源软件项目,是基于Java开发的一种工具,可扩展的持续集成、交付、部署(软件/代码的编译、打包、部署)的基于web界面的平台。允许持续集成和持续交付项目,无论用的是什么平台,可以处理任何类型的构建或持续集成。官网:https://jenkins.io/官方文档:https://jenkins.io/zh/doc/Jenkins特点
转载
2024-01-13 07:43:36
50阅读
一、针对jenkins本地docker主机首先需要配置jenkins + gitlab自动触发更新:主机ip作用server1172.25.63.1gitlab主机server2172.25.63.2jenkins+docker主机server3172.25.63.3harbor仓库主机server4172.25.63.4docker主机首先需要在jenkins安装docker的插件:准备harb
转载
2024-03-01 11:22:55
61阅读
文章目录jenkins安装创建挂载文件运行一个容器获取jenkins镜像运行容器初始化配置安装插件全局工具配置系统设置部署docker项目 jenkins安装本文使用docker安装的方式,主要用于maven项目的打包,使用docker插件生成镜像容器发布。需要读者了解docker相关的基本命令。创建挂载文件创建docker挂载文件夹, jenkins持久化数据文件夹,方便管理数据,而且重新生成
转载
2023-07-17 23:01:44
255阅读
目录一、实现思路二、环境准备1、在mac上安装docker2、docker安装jenkins三、配置jenkins容器四、 jenkins插件安装 1、安装git 2、安装docker 3、html Publisher安装4、 pipeline安装5、安装后重启jenkins容器五、创建jenkins任务1、重新登录jenkins,点击new item2、选择创建pi
转载
2024-03-09 19:15:58
67阅读
在docker里运行jenkins server。 文章来自:http://www.ciandcd.com文中的代码来自可以
原创
2022-07-27 21:41:58
292阅读
本文需要使用Docker,Jenkins 使用到的环境依次为: 1:Centos7 2: Docker 3: gitee存储springboot 还没安装docker的请看这: Docker一键安装。 还没安装Jenkins的同学请看这:Jenkins一键安装。Jenkins需要安装的插件有 使用的Springboot项目为:https://gitee.com/y_project/RuoYi 将此
转载
2023-09-20 11:58:37
105阅读
# Jenkins和Docker区别
## 简介
在软件开发领域,Jenkins和Docker是两个非常流行的工具。Jenkins是一个自动化构建工具,可以用于持续集成和持续交付。而Docker是一个轻量级的容器化平台,可以打包应用程序及其所有依赖项。
本文将介绍Jenkins和Docker的区别,并指导如何使用它们进行软件开发。
## Jenkins和Docker使用流程
下面是使用Je
原创
2024-04-24 12:38:10
104阅读
Docker+Jenkins_自动化持续集成 1、软件简述: Jenkins是一个开源软件项目,旨在提供一个开放易用的软件平台,使软件的持续集成变成可能。 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的 Linux 机器上,也可以实现虚拟化。容器是完全使用沙箱机制,相互之间不会有任何接口。
转载
2023-12-11 20:04:51
97阅读
Jenkins与Docker Swarm的结合
## 引言
在现代软件开发中,自动化构建和部署已经成为一个必不可少的环节。Jenkins和Docker Swarm是两个非常流行的工具,它们分别用于构建和管理应用程序的自动化过程。本文将介绍Jenkins和Docker Swarm的基本概念,并展示如何将它们结合起来进行自动化的部署。
## Jenkins简介
Jenkins是一个开源的持续集
原创
2023-12-18 10:24:18
71阅读
摘要环境准备具体安装步骤jenkins创建job构建springCloud项目发送到镜像仓库rancher添加主机并创建应用部署springCloud项目测试springCloud项目搭建过程注意的事项一、环境准备准备两台服务器master(192.168.10.17),node1(192.168.10.16)master和node1均安装dockermaster节点安装java,maven,je
转载
2024-06-24 11:17:52
40阅读
一文完成Jenkins+Docker+Git(多分支构建)打包、部署,实现可持续化集成Jenkins简介什么是Jenkins?其他CI工具什么是持续集成Jenkins 状态构建稳定性安装Jenkins基于Linux基于Dockerdocker命令启动docker-compose 启动安装时遇到的坑中文只翻译一半配置打包环境安装JDK下载jdk解压配置jdk环境变量安装Maven下载maven解压
转载
2024-03-05 14:12:06
49阅读
本文介绍如何通过Jenkins的docker镜像从零开始构建一个基于docker镜像的持续集成环境,包含自动化构建、发布到仓库\并部署上线。0. 前置条件#
服务器安装docker,并启动docker swarm注意docker启动时,需要开启tcp端口1.Jenkins 安装#
1.1 命令行启动:#
安装比较简单,直接运行 Copydocker run -p 8080:8080
转载
2023-09-13 07:11:22
98阅读
由于采用了Docker版的Jenkins,导致在Jenkins里无法调用Docker命令行工具进行Docker镜像构建 有三种解决方案:1. 安装Docker插件,利用Jenkins插件进行构建2. 重新安装一个包含Docker和Jenkins的构建服务器3. 把Jenkins安装在主机上,利用主机的Docker工具进行构建
转载
2023-06-12 15:28:45
110阅读
一、系统环境组件版本Centos7.6.1810Jenkins2.319.1Docker20.10.12Docker-Compose1.29.2HARBOR2.4.1 1、HARBOR分1.0和2.0两个大版本,根据自己需要选择版本 2、安装包分离线和在线安装版,我们选择离线安装包 3、解压安装包sudo tar -zxvf harbor-offline-installer-v2.4.1
转载
2024-05-14 14:49:51
34阅读
学习了一周的CICD,踩了很多坑,都是泪,特此记录一下整个过程,本次项目产出效果是,git push的时候自动化直接部署到服务器上,一下是整个大致流程:image.png1.本地代码push到gitlab 2.gitlab通过webhook通知到jenkins 3.jenkins拉取gitlab仓库代码,并执行shell脚本 4.shell脚本执行docker命令,打包项目 5.安装nginx,并
转载
2024-07-04 15:22:29
106阅读
--昨夜西风凋碧树,独上高楼,望尽天涯路官网原文:https://jenkins.io/doc/定义执行环境变量前面我们注意到了Jen
转载
2023-07-25 15:17:39
179阅读